| | | Hungry Dogs. | | |
|
Hungry dogs will eat dirty puddings. | 1 |
|
To the hungry soul every bitter thing is sweet. (Prov. xxvii. 7.) | 2 |
|
When bread is wanting oaten cakes are excellent. | 3 |
|
Latin: | 4 |
| |
| Jejunus raro stomachus vulgaria temnit. (Horace.) | |
|
|
French: | 5 |
| |
| A la faim il ny a point de mauvais pain. |
| A ventre affamé tout est bon. |
| Ventre affamé na point doreilles. | |
|
|
Italian: | 6 |
| |
| Lasino chi a fame mangia dogni strame. | |
|
|
German: | 7 |
| |
| Wem kase und brod nicht schmeckt, der ist nicht hungrig. | |
